Deacons Letter - 8th October

8/10/2021

 
Kia ora All Saints Whānau,

What a joy it was to meet together again last week! I (Emily) feel so grateful that we could do this when so many in the world can't. Chris shared a great message with three pieces of advice Jesus gave his disciples, but the first really stood out to me: "Don’t be alarmed in the face of world turmoil." There are many things happening in the world right now which can feel alarming, but I believe Jesus’ words would be the same to us today - do not be alarmed. Through the Spirit we can have peace during hard times and confident hope that things will not always be this way. God's kingdom brings healing and restoration.

Perhaps this week you could consider how your heart is in this time. Are you feeling alarmed? Are you holding onto the hope Jesus offers? Are you finding ways to join God in bringing healing and restoration to our world (or maybe just to a friend, neighbour or stranger)?

As we meet together in our house churches this week, I encourage you to use the time to truly engage in your faith. Enjoy the smaller group setting, the conversation, the snacks (my favourite part), and encourage and spur one another on to help our hurting world. As you do, know that we are praying for you, and may the peace of God, which surpasses all understanding, guard your heart and your mind in Christ Jesus.

​Emily, Andy, Guy and Summer
